I think Ryle is getting to much credit for a weak schedule. If you look at the stats Ryle has scored 267 points and given up 100. The average for 6 games is 46 for and 17 against. If you take away the 3 games vs winless teams it's 94 scored and 76 against. The average drops to 31 points scored and 25 given up. I did the same for Cooper but only dropped Campbell County since that is the only winless team they have played.

 

Cooper has scored 177 and given up 89 which breaks down to 25.3 scored and 13 given up per game. If you drop the Campbell County stats it's 142 for and 82 against which makes the average 24 points for and 14 against. These teams are very close and to date Cooper has played a tougher schedule. The good thing is this will be settled on the field and not in this forum.
